Abstract
To compute the magnetic fields in electrical machines as well as various instruments driven by electric motor or actuator, it is of paramount importance to know the local magnetization characteristics of ferromagnetic materials constituting such electronic devices. We are now developing one of the local magnetization characteristics methods by means of the simple dynamic magnetic domain movement visualization. Even through our approach makes it possible to know the local magnetization characteristics referenced on the global magnetization curve, the computed local magnetization characteristics at distinct positions of ferromagnetic thin sheet reveals enormous microscopic characters of the ferromagnetic materials
